The idea that we’re fated to die and that it just happens is itself going away. There’s always a specific reason, and we’re getting better at identifying it. If the person was 95 and suffered heart failure, it’s appropriate to say “died of old age” because basically, your organs have already severely degraded and the heart was just the first to go.
